About the role

This role focuses on integrating artificial intelligence into all aspects of marketing operations at Serotonin. The successful candidate will audit current workflows across content, social media, public relations, growth, and design, then redesign them using AI tools to improve efficiency, quality, and scalability. This involves creating and maintaining AI-powered content and campaign pipelines for both internal teams and client accounts, with the goal of reducing manual effort while preserving brand standards.

A key part of this position is establishing the operational framework for AI adoption across the 90-person global team. This includes developing and managing a firm-wide prompt library, standard operating procedures for AI use, and workflow playbooks. The engineer will also be responsible for identifying, evaluating, and integrating new AI tools relevant to marketing and go-to-market strategies, ensuring Serotonin's AI stack remains current.

Success in this role means not only building and implementing AI solutions but also proving their impact. The engineer will define and track metrics such as time saved, output volume, quality scores, and client adoption, reporting these findings to leadership. Additionally, they will train marketing teams across the firm, enhancing their AI fluency and ensuring widespread, effective use of new tools and workflows.

From the employer

  • Audit existing marketing workflows across content, social, PR, growth, and design, and systematically redesign them with AI tooling to increase speed, quality, and scale
  • Build and maintain AI-powered content and campaign pipelines for internal teams and client accounts, reducing manual effort without sacrificing brand quality
  • Develop and own a firm-wide prompt library, AI SOPs, and workflow playbooks - the operational backbone that makes AI adoption stick across a 90-person global team
  • Identify, evaluate, and onboard new AI tools relevant to marketing and GTM; maintain and evolve the firm’s AI tooling stack as the landscape shifts
  • Partner with client teams to diagnose GTM bottlenecks and design AI-assisted solutions - from content at scale to campaign automation to research synthesis
  • Build no-code and low-code automations that connect AI tools into existing martech stacks (HubSpot, Notion, Slack, social platforms) using tools like Make, Zapier, or n8n
  • Train and upskill marketing teams across the firm on AI tools and workflows, raising the baseline AI fluency of every team you work with
  • Define and track the metrics that prove AI workflow impact - time saved, output volume, quality scores, and client adoption, and report findings to leadership.
  • Expert-level prompt engineering across major LLMs (Claude, ChatGPT, Gemini, Perplexity)
  • Hands-on experience with AI creative tools: image generation (Midjourney, Adobe Firefly), video (Runway, Sora, Kling), and audio (ElevenLabs) in a real marketing context
  • Workflow automation using no-code/low-code platforms (Make, Zapier, n8n)
  • Comfortable working with APIs, webhooks, and JSON
  • Familiarity with AI-native martech: HubSpot AI, Jasper, Copy.ai, Notion AI, Sprout Social
  • Experience building prompt templates, internal AI playbooks, and training materials
  • Ability to use AI tools to synthesize research, competitive intelligence, and market data
  • Comfort measuring the performance of AI-assisted campaigns and workflows
  • Familiarity with analytics tools (GA4, HubSpot analytics, basic SQL a plus)
  • Strong critical thinking around AI outputs.
